Output 34003a915f28b6a405099f81d4d1839f6f757e59b19b6e276308430fb2a913dd:0

value
26219634
script pubkey
OP_0 OP_PUSHBYTES_20 6b5484ff9454255fa8d70e43cbc7c65145678c18
address
bc1qdd2gflu52sj4l2xhpepuh37x29zk0rqcs594gw
transaction
34003a915f28b6a405099f81d4d1839f6f757e59b19b6e276308430fb2a913dd
spent
true